  • Can the Smart Sock be worn on either foot?
  • Your Smart Sock was designed to work on either the right or left foot. If used on the right foot, the sensor dome should be on the top of the foot. If used on the left foot, the sensor dome should be on the bottom of the foot.
  • How do I put on the sock? - Sock placement
  • Each sock has a notch to help you put the sock in the place. The sock notch should be placed 1cm behind the pinky toe on either foot. This will make sure the sensor is in the best position to receive accurate readings.
  • Putting on the sock. How tight should the sock be?
  • The Smart Sock should be securely placed on your baby's foot but not too tight. The overlapping velcro should never be secured beyond the base velcro. The Sock notch should be 1cm behind the pinky toe.
  • Can you wear the Smart Sock under footie pajamas?
  • Yes! Just make sure the Smart Sock is directly next to the skin. We recommend using your best judgment selecting pajamas that are not too tight or too hot. Excessive moisture and pressure may cause skin irritation on baby's sensitive skin.
  • How do I insert the sensor?
  • Make sure you can see the light in the windows. Carefully insert the sensor, narrow end first. Make sure the dome is tucked all the way inside. You should be able to see the two lights through the vinyl windows.
